An attempted burglary of a strip club goes awry when one of the three burglars kills a man who draws a gun. This results in the trio taking the dancers and the customers hostage. Why the robbers don't go ahead and escape when the shooting occurs is beyond the viewer. Then all the hostages escape and hide in the club's refrigerator which sort of indicates the intelligence of the stick-up men. Unfortunately, the cops outside are no more intelligent as they stand around outside wondering what to do as one of the strippers who was released crawls back into an extremely large venting system for a small club and rescues the hostages with the help of an ex-cop held inside the club.

The film's tagline is: "...At Your Own Risk"
The runtime is 82 minutes (1h 22m).
The film was directed by Alan Smithee.
The screenplay was written by Brent V. Friedman and Joe Augustyn.
The score was composed by Kevin Kiner.
Cinematography was handled by David B. Nowell.
